Answer: The price for one adult ticket is $10 and the price for one child ticket is $7.

Step-by-step explanation:

<h3> The correct exercise is: "At a movie theater, the price of 2 adult tickets and 4 children tickets is 48$. The price of 5 adult tickets and 2 child tickets is 64$. What is the price for one adult and one child?"</h3>

Let be "a" the price (in dollars) for one adult ticket and "c" the price (in dollars) for one child ticket.

Set up a System of equations with the data given in the exercise:

\left \{ {{2a+4c=48} \atop {5a+2c=64}} \right.

You can use the Elimination method to solve the System of equations:

1. Multiply the second equation by -2.

2. Add the equations.

3. Solve for "a".

Then:

\left \{ {{2a+4c=48} \atop {-10a-4c=-128}} \right.\\........................\\-8a=-80\\\\a=\frac{-80}{-8}\\\\a=10

4. Substitute the value of "a" into any original equation.

5. Solve for "c":

2(10)+4c=48\\\\4c=48-20\\\\c=\frac{28}{4}\\\\c=7

A standard number cube, numbered 1 through 6 on each side, is rolled 3 times. What is the probability of rolling a 2 on all thre
nikklg [1K]

Answer:

The answer is 1/216

Step-by-step explanation:

The probability of getting a 2 on a six-sided number cube is 1/6 because the number "2" appears on just one out of the six faces.

Since, the probability of getting a 2 in the first throw is independent of the probability of getting a 2 in the subsequent throws, we multiply these probabilities:

P (2, 2, 2) = 1/6 x 1/6 x 1/6

P = 1/216
